Light Scattering Aerosol Monitoring For Fire Evacuation

Fire is a major disaster threatening people’s lives and property.Realizing early fire warning can reduce fire hazards and buy precious time for fire evacuation.At present,domestic fire and fire early warning are mainly realized through specific smoke detectors and video image monitoring.They have rapid early warning capabilities in specific occasions,but they have a small range of adaptation,low flexibility and high costs.Therefore,it is imperative to design a more flexible and stable fire monitoring system.Based on the characteristics of smoke and aerosols in the early stage of a fire,the paper studies laser measurement and flow measurement technology,and designs and implements a light scattering aerosol monitoring system for fire evacuation.The hardware platform of the system collected aerosol wind speed,temperature and concentration data,and transmitted the data to the control terminal for calibration and processing,and completed the comparative verification of various model fitting methods.The software side of the system realizes the corresponding data recording,display,analysis and early warning functions.The system has a faster response speed,higher flexibility and lower cost,and has a variety of working modes at the same time,which can complete active or passive monitoring according to different environments and requirements.The work done in the paper is as follows:(1)According to the composition and formation principle of aerosol,analyze the indoor aerosol particle monitoring method,and select the method of laser measurement combined with flow measurement.Based on the characteristics of indoor aerosol particles and the principle of scattering,a specific design plan for collecting aerosol data by light scattering is obtained.Completed the optical tracking simulation and the design and realization of the laser cavity structure.Using the constant temperature measurement method,a mathematical model of aerosol flow is established.(2)According to the selected concentration light scattering measurement method and flow constant temperature measurement method,the hardware construction of the monitoring system is completed.In order to enhance the stability and sensitivity of the hardware platform,amplifying,filtering and feedback circuits have been added,and each module circuit has been designed and improved.The physical circuit board was produced,and the test and calibration were completed.(3)Based on the established mathematical models of flow and concentration,the embedded software and control terminal software were designed and implemented,and the measured data were analyzed.The software system receives the concentration,wind speed and temperature data from the hardware side,completes data processing tasks such as noise reduction,fitting,and calibration,and records the working mode,power state and laser working state.Finally,these data and status are visualized and transformed into intuitive working conditions,aerosol concentrations,and related analysis charts.The light scattering aerosol monitoring system for fire evacuation achieves the expected results in the test.It ensures the reliability and flexibility while monitoring aerosol at a high reaction rate,and has a wide application prospect.
